**Amentum** is seeking a **Program Engineer** to join our team in the Engineering department in West Palm Beach, FL in support of the Atlantic Undersea Testing and Evaluation Center (AUTEC) mission. The Program Engineer is responsible for being the point of contact to NUWC, US Navy, and contractor personnel for the planning and conduct of testing on the AUTEC test ranges and is accountable to the Test Planning Manager. **Must be able to obtain and maintain a Secret U.S. Government Clearance. Note: U.S. Citizenship is required to obtain a Secret Clearance.** **Essential Duties:** • Evaluate assigned test support requirements and determine best method(s) for accomplishing all aspects of each program/test within the existing parameters of AUTEC capabilities to match/satisfy customer needs/requirements. Define new capabilities or additional resources if such are required. • Accountable for cost control management and technical instruction tasking guidance related to test support and projects as assigned. This responsibility comprises monitoring costs and expenditures of all departments engaged in supporting test activities and coordinating status of funding with NUWC Subject Matter Experts and Contractor Finance. • ISO assigned programs/tests, arrange for any necessary shore facility, test asset preparation/modification, shipping, staging, proper management of any HAZMAT/HAZWASTE, and/or pre/post-test logistic support.
